WordPress 编辑器自动缩进发表文章的首行
橘子皮304 次
我们通常写文章时,段落首行都会空两格,可是WordPress自带的编辑器却没有考虑到这一点,导致发布的文章首行都是顶格的,看起来很不习惯。
我们通常的解决方法都是在发布文章时把编辑器切换到“文本”模式,然后再在首行手动键入两个全角的空格来实现的。但是这有两个弊端,一是麻烦,编辑不方便;再一个就是如果日后更换成了首行会自动空两格的主题,就会变成了首先空四个空格。
所以,最好的解决方法就是能实现发布文章时自动空两格,我们可以通过修改主题的style.css样式表文件来实现。方法如下:

以橘子皮使用的简单pure主题为例。 编辑 style.css 并找到:
.post-content p {
margin-bottom: 20px;
text-indent: 0em;
}
然后更改把0em 改成2em
这样再发布文章时,段落首行就会自动缩进两个空格了。
如果你使用的是其他主题,可以在style.css中找到类似 .***** p { 这样的控制文章正文换行样式的代码,加入以上代码即可。
如果一个新手想添加首行缩进,但又不知道CSS什么的,那是无法实现的。 为此,我无聊折腾了一个简单的方法来实现,在主题目录functions.php中添加如下代码,第一行可以自动缩进,其他什么都不需要调整。
//文章首行缩进
function Bing_text_indent($text){
$return = str_replace('<p', '<p style="text-indent:2em;"',$text);
return $return;
}
add_filter('the_content','Bing_text_indent');
评论 | 0 条评论
登录之后才可留言,前往登录